History & sales

Porsche has been selling luxury cars in India since 2004, delivering a total of 1,052 units to the customers in India, out of which 85 percent are Cayenne SUV models. In order to become the leading automobile luxury brand in the Indian automotive market,
Porsche Dr. Ing. h.c. F. Porsche AG, usually shortened to Porsche (; see below), is a German automobile manufacturer specializing in luxury, high-performance sports cars, SUVs and sedans, headquartered in Stuttgart, Baden-Württemberg, Germany. Th ...
had established Porsche India as its division. As in January 2013, the company planned to extend its sale in India by establishing new centres in India.
